我正在尝试构建一个应用程序来获取Google日历信息,例如日历、事件等,但我遇到了一个大问题。这是我的代码:#defineGoogleClientID@"clientid"#defineGoogleClientSecret@"secret"#defineGoogleAuthURL@"https://accounts.google.com/o/oauth2/auth"#defineGoogleTokenURL@"https://accounts.google.com/o/oauth2/token"NSString*constkKeychainItemName=@"CalendarPane
关闭。这个问题需要更多focused.它目前不接受答案。想改进这个问题吗?更新问题,使其只关注一个问题editingthispost.关闭6年前。Improvethisquestion我正在尝试创建一个包含day-view-calendar的应用程序。我知道有很多问题与我的隐含相同,但我还没有找到让我清楚的答案。我想制作一个包含多个(5或6)列的day-view-calendar。这样您就可以在一个View中为5或6个不同的用户添加项目。此外,我希望布局类似于iPhone日历日View。我是新来的,有人可以帮我解决我的“问题”吗?
我的应用显示消息列表,每条消息都有一个创建日期。我不想只显示日期,而是根据从创建日期过去的时间显示不同的格式。例如,这是我从日期创建日期字符串的方式:NSDate*date=someMessage.creationDate;NSTimeIntervaltimePassed=[[NSDatedate]timeIntervalSinceDate:date];if(timePassed所以现在我想添加以下情况:elseif("timePassed24hours,orwithinpreviouscalendarday"){//dosomethingelse}但不知道怎么做,任何帮助将不胜感激
我想确定iOS中当前日期的日、月和年。我在网上搜索后发现了这个:NSDate*date=[NSDatedate];NSCalendar*calendar=[[NSCalendaralloc]initWithCalendarIdentifier:NSGregorianCalendar];NSDateComponents*components=[calendarcomponents:(NSDayCalendarUnit)fromDate:date];NSIntegerDay=[componentsday];NSIntegermonth=[componentsmonth];NSInteger
我正在查看这篇维基百科文章:http://en.wikipedia.org/wiki/Day_lengthhttp://en.wikipedia.org/wiki/Sunrise_equation有人有过使用上述方程式和GPS给出的纬度在iOS上计算日出/日落时间的经验吗?我也对太阳正午感兴趣。我的想法是创建一个时钟,其中太阳围绕一个固定按钮旋转,以真正的“模拟”意义指示时间......然后日出/日落时间将允许我将“太阳”的轨道定位在按钮周围对于一年中的某一天,给人的印象是白天还有多少时间,还有多少时间已经过期。iPhone以某种方式自动调整亮度,您知道这是基于通过光传感器的环境光还是
在尝试使用我的方法之前(我觉得这种方法过于简单而且过于冗长),我想问问任何人在Swift中是否有更简单/更直接的方法。任务是让用户选择日历中的任何一天。假设他们在一个月前选择了星期二。现在我想将整个星期放入一个数组中。所以之前的星期一,然后是星期二,然后是星期三、星期四、星期五、星期六、星期日。因此数组将始终保持7天。事情是这样的——我想改变它,以便用户可以定义他们的“开始日”是什么——例如,如果我指定星期四作为我的开始日,那么如果我再次选择一个随机的星期二从几个月前开始,该数组应如下所示:[Thurs/Fri/Sat/Sun/Mon/Tues/Wed](该数组始终从用户的开始日期开始
建议全部看完再进行操作。 因为需要下载BitTorrent(种子),所以安装了迅雷,然而迅雷自带捆绑软件迅雷影音。我通过控制面板卸载了迅雷之后,无法通过控制面板删除迅雷影音,在迅雷安装目录中找不到unstall卸载程序,同时该软件频繁自动修改默认播放器。随便点击一个视频文件播放(由于迅雷影音自动变为默认播放器,所以随便点击一个视频文件,就会运行迅雷影音),右键任务栏,点击任务管理器,找到迅雷影音,右键,点击展开,再次右键,点击打开文件所在的位置,这样就差不多找到了安装目录。下面是解决方法右键电脑最左下角的 开始菜单(形状是四个方块),点击Windows PowerShell(管理员)(A),输
我正在使用Swift3,我想打印两个日期之间的每一天。例如:08-10-2017->开始日期08-15-2017->结束日期应该打印:08-10-201708-11-201708-12-201708-13-201708-14-201708-15-2017我想获取两个特定日期的范围,有人可以帮我解决一下吗?我试图将这两个日期放入for循环但没有机会。 最佳答案 您需要创建一个基于日期的日历,并开始增加开始日期直到到达结束日期。这是一个代码片段,如何做:funcshowRange(betweenstartDate:Date,andend
你好,我有一个这样的约会2016-02-1000:00:00我只想以这种方式从中获取日期14.05.2016or14-05-2016这是我试过的letdateFormatter=NSDateFormatter()letdate="2016-02-1000:00:00"dateFormatter.dateFormat="dd-MM-yyyy"letnewdate=dateFormatter.dateFromString(date)print(newdate)//niliscoming 最佳答案 比提议的版本更好的方法是不使用字符串格式
我有一个应用程序可以将日历列表加载到选择器View中。它可以工作,但只有在应用程序崩溃并再次打开后才能工作。我不确定为什么它在应用程序的初始打开时不起作用。日历权限请求:funcrequestCalendarPermissions(){eventInstance.requestAccess(to:.event,completion:{(accessGranted:Bool,error:Error?)inifaccessGranted==true{print("AccessHasBeenGranted")}else{print("ChangeSettingstoAllowAccess")